#956854 color RGB value is (149,104,84). #956854 color name is Custom Color color.
#956854 hex color red value is 149, green value is 104 and the blue value of its RGB is 84.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#956854 hue: 0.05, saturation: 0.28 and the lightness value of 956854 is 0.46.
The process color (four color CMYK) of #956854 color hex is 0.00, 0.30, 0.44, 0.42. Web safe color of #956854 is #996666. Color #956854 contains mainly ORANGE color.

About #956854 Custom Color
#956854 (Custom Color) is a orange-based color with RGB values of 149, 104, 84. This color belongs to the orange color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.
When working with #956854,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.
For web development, #956854 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#956854), RGB (rgb(149, 104, 84)), HSL (hsl(18, 28%, 46%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#996666,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
